VectorStoreWriter<T> Classe
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Scrive blocchi nell'oggetto VectorStore usando lo schema predefinito.
generic <typename T>
public ref class VectorStoreWriter sealed : Microsoft::Extensions::DataIngestion::IngestionChunkWriter<T>
public sealed class VectorStoreWriter<T> : Microsoft.Extensions.DataIngestion.IngestionChunkWriter<T>
type VectorStoreWriter<'T> = class
inherit IngestionChunkWriter<'T>
Public NotInheritable Class VectorStoreWriter(Of T)
Inherits IngestionChunkWriter(Of T)
Parametri di tipo
- T
Tipo di contenuto del blocco.
- Ereditarietà
Costruttori
| Nome | Descrizione |
|---|---|
| VectorStoreWriter<T>(VectorStore, Int32, VectorStoreWriterOptions) |
Inizializza una nuova istanza della classe VectorStoreWriter<T>. |
Proprietà
| Nome | Descrizione |
|---|---|
| VectorStoreCollection |
Ottiene l'oggetto sottostante VectorStoreCollection<TKey,TRecord> utilizzato per archiviare i blocchi. |
Metodi
| Nome | Descrizione |
|---|---|
| Dispose() |
Elimina il writer e rilascia tutte le risorse associate. (Ereditato da IngestionChunkWriter<T>) |
| Dispose(Boolean) |
Elimina il writer. (Ereditato da IngestionChunkWriter<T>) |
| WriteAsync(IAsyncEnumerable<IngestionChunk<T>>, CancellationToken) |
Scrive blocchi in modo asincrono. |